Slope stability analysis with FLAC and limit equilibrium methods
The factor of safety for slopes (FS) has been traditionally evaluated using two-dimensional limit equilibrium methods (LEM). However the FS of a slope can also be computed with FLAC by reducing the soil shear strength in stages until the slope fails. This method is called the shear strength reduction technique (SSR).
